我正在尝试创建一个流畅的页面,正在由其他一些数据模板html" target="_blank">构建。
例如:
我有两个数据模板
。
>
DataTemplate1
=>StackPanel中的按钮和Textblock。如:
stackpanel << [Button] textblockwithtext >>
DataTemplate2
=>StackPanel中的Textblock和Combobox。如:
stackpanel << 11111111thisisnewtextblock >> [ComboBox]
在我将它们合并之后,这是第三个模板(类似于:
stackpanel << DataTemplate1 DataTemplate 2 >>
我会得到一些不流利的东西。可能都是一脉相承的,
或者是两条线,但它会在中间断裂,比如:
按钮文本1\n
文本2\n组合框。
我想要一些像这样的东西:按钮\n文本1和文本2的一半\n文本2的最后一半和组合框。(根据窗口的空间大小)。
所以,我想找到一个工作的包装方式,当我使用两个datatemplates(包装面板不是我要找的,我正在寻找一种方法合并两个datatemplates-让它们互相包装,这样它们就不会是一个完全不同的部分)。
我尝试使用run in Document,但几乎不可能为它们创建datatemplate。
有什么想法吗?
多谢了。
够近了?
<DataTemplate>
<Grid>
<Grid.RowDefinitions>
<RowDefinition />
<RowDefinition />
<RowDefinition />
</Grid.RowDefinitions>
<Grid.ColumnDefinitions>
<ColumnDefinition/>
<ColumnDefinition/>
</Grid.ColumnDefinitions>
<Button Grid.ColSpan="2" />
<TextBlock Grid.Row="1" Grid.ColSpan="2">
<Run Text="{Binding Text1}" />
<Run Text="{Binding Text2 , Converter={StaticResource StringToSubStringConverter,ConverterParameter=0}}" />
</TextBlock>
<Text Text="{Binding Text2 , Converter={StaticResource StringToSubStringConverter,ConverterParameter=1}}" Grid.Row="2"
<ComboBox Grid.Column="1" Grid.Row="2" />
</Grid>
</DataTemplate>
转换器参数的1和0表示下半部分和上半部分。
了解如何从现有文档创建 Dreamweaver 模板、使用“资源”面板来创建一个新模板或创建 Contribute 站点的模板。 可以基于现有文档(如 HTML)创建模板,也可以从新文档创建模板。 创建模板后,可以插入模板区域,并为代码颜色和模板区域高亮颜色设置模板的首选参数。 注意:您可以在模板的“设计备注”文件中存储关于模板的附加信息(如创作者、上一次更改的时间或做出某些布局决定的原因)。基于
我正在尝试使用Compose设计一个布局,其中包括: 顶部应用栏 正文(内容) 底部应用栏 单击时表示菜单的底页(模式底页) -------顶应用栏------- -主要内容- ------底部压条----- ----模型底板--- Compose提供了3个组件: 脚手架 底板脚手架 模态底板布局 脚手架没有底板属性 BottomSheetScaffold没有BottomAppBar属性 Moda
问题内容: 如何在Java中创建20个随机字节的数组? 问题答案: 尝试方法:
我发现自己经常重复的内容。例如,对于典型的应用程序,这将如下所示: 根据执行dockerfile的项目,这里只有三件事是动态的:,,
我有一个模板化的C++类,它也有一个模板化的成员函数。这个成员函数的模板参数以特定的方式依赖于类的模板参数(请参阅下面的代码)。我正在为其模板参数的两个不同值实例化(而不是专门化)该类。一切都在这一点上进行。但是,如果我调用模板化的成员函数,对第一个实例化对象的调用只会编译,而不会编译第二个。似乎编译器没有为模板类的第二次实例化实例化模板化成员函数。我正在使用“g++filename.cpp”编译
本文向大家介绍Angular如何由模板生成DOM树的方法,包括了Angular如何由模板生成DOM树的方法的使用技巧和注意事项,需要的朋友参考一下 Angular等现代Web框架极大的提高了开发效率,比如我们经常会在开发过程中写出类似下面的代码: 这种模板写法并不是HTML原生支持的,那么Angular又是如何转换这些代码,并显示成我们期望的界面呢? 首先我们来看看Angular把上述代码编译成什